Yes and they don't make enough money to live in the expensive cities. Even the modeling apartments charge a ton of rent just to give them a bed. That's just another way they make money out of these young girls. They start having to go to parties that sort of hire models to be there, that swiftly runs into "go sit with this rich guy that gives you tips" right into escorting. Plus it seems especially eastern europeans and russian girls are raised to think marrying rich is a good option if you are pretty , but these guys are not going to marry you. And she would be ashamed of telling her mother what she'd been doing. Shame leads to selfloathing.
